The body was found near where a man went missing earlier this month

HAMILTON - A State Police marine unit pulled the body of a man from the Delaware River Monday morning near where a man went missing earlier this month, authorities said.

The body was found by off Lamberton Road near the Public Service Gas & Electric generation plant around 9:30 a.m., Sgt. Gregory Williams said.

The Mercer County Medical Examiner is working to identify the body, which was pulled from the water around 11 a.m., Williams said.

A marine unit from the Trenton Fire Department also responded to the scene, Williams said.

The incident is under investigation, Williams said.

Jesus Diaz Melendez, 26, has been missing since he and a friend were ejected after running aground in the Delaware on May 7.

A group of boaters rescued Melendez's friend from the shore around 7 p.m. 

The friend, who was not identified, told rescuers he and Melendez ran aground and both men were ejected from his boat. Melendez was the operator of the boat but neither man was wearing a life jacket, the friend said.
